Today we discussed chapters 7 and 8 of "Outlive You Life"

Chapter 7, "See the Need; Touch the hurt", referenced Jesus' use of physical touch for healing and how that allowed him to make a personal and meaningfull connection with the ones he healed and the witnesses. We discussed how much impact seeing and listening to someone can have.

Chapter 8, "Persecution: Prepare for It; Resist It", talked about how we will face persecution for our beliefs. Our persecution may not be life threatening, but we can draw strength from examples of people who did risk it all for their faith.

We discussed chapters 5 and 6 of our book. Chapter 5 (Team Up) was summed up as "No one can do everything, but everyone can do something." Chapter 6 (Open You Door; Open Your Heart) led to discussion about how we need to work to be hospitable even if everything isn't "perfect." We don't have to have the perfect meal, or the perfectly cleaned house just an open door.
